The Beacon Hill Civic Association, Inc. (BHCA) is a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ization that operates according to its bylaws and produces an Annual Report (as posted on our committee bulletin board) of accomplishments and statement of financial condition. The BHCA's operational structure includes a small professional staff, including an Executive Director, and an active, volunteer Board of Officers, Vice Presidents, and Directors who carry out the day-to-day efforts of the BHCA on behalf of the neighborhood. Members and donors offer support through annual dues and donations of time and money.

Board The BHCA Board is comprised of Officers, Vice Presidents and Directors. The Executive Committee, comprised of the Chairman, President, Vice Presidents, Treasurer, and Clerk, serves to advise on the day-to-day operations of the organization.
Officers We nominate and elect officers annually in the Spring. Officers serve for a one-year term. Officers serving for the 2007 - 2008 term:

Directors Limited to 35 members, the BHCA Directors includes a cross section of individuals who live and work on Beacon Hill. We nominate and elect directors annually in the Spring. Directors serve for a one-year term. Directors serve as committee chairs and are often involved with multiple committees based on their backgrounds and areas of interest.
There are no term limits for directors and many serve for multiple years; there are typically a handful of vacancies each year. Staff
The BHCA employs two full-time administrators who are responsible for office operations and supporting the board and committees.
Executive Director*
In July 2007, Suzanne Besser returned to the BHCA as Executive Director, a position she formerly held from 1998 to 2004. Throughout her career, she has served in that capacity for other nonprofit organizations. During her recent hiatus from the BHCA, she tried her hand at writing and editing for the Beacon Hill Times and the Back Bay Sun work she also enjoyed.
A native of Connecticut and graduate of Brown University, Suzanne moved with her husband, John, to Beacon Hill in 1997. Now residents of Acorn Street, the couple, who has four children and five young grandchildren, are bicycling, sculling and kayaking enthusiasts.
